The story unfolds across multiple Indian cities. Chintu's ordinary life is rooted in Kanpur, Vedika teaches in Lucknow, and Tapasya's world exists in Delhi. A subplot involving plans to elope to Canada also emerges, with key scenes at an airport and travel agency.
Earlier scenes establish Kanpur and Lucknow as the primary settings before the story expands to Delhi and eventually the airport.
The narrative is set in modern-day India during the late 2010s, specifically 2019. The story reflects contemporary urban middle-class life with the pressures of marriage, ambition, and social expectations that are relevant to that era.
The movie explores several interconnected themes including infidelity, where a fabricated affair triggers a crisis of trust; deception, as lies drive the entire plot forward; forgiveness, shown when Vedika chooses to reconcile at the airport; and family pressure, which illustrates the weight of traditional expectations on a middle-class couple.
Chintu Tyagi is a middle-class government engineer from Kanpur who feels trapped in routine domestic life. He seeks excitement and thrill beyond his ordinary existence, which leads him into a complicated entanglement with another woman while struggling to manage the consequences of his choices.
Vedika Tripathi is a schoolteacher from Lucknow who is married to Chintu. She faces pressure from family expectations to start a family while longing for a bigger life in a new city. When she discovers her husband's infidelity, she goes through a period of crisis before ultimately choosing to forgive and reconcile.
Tapasya Singh is an aspiring fashion designer from Delhi who becomes romantically involved with Chintu. She represents excitement and romance outside of marriage, and her pursuit of Chintu pushes the central couple toward a crossroads, testing loyalties and boundaries in the relationship.
Canada appears as the destination representing escape from domestic life and routine. Characters scheme to move there as a way of fleeing their current circumstances and pursuing new beginnings, symbolizing the dream of a different, potentially better life away from the pressures of their everyday existence in India.
The movie explores how infidelity damages trust between partners, but ultimately suggests that forgiveness can restore what deceit breaks. Despite the betrayals and lies, the ending shows reconciliation and renewed commitment, implying that commitment and love matter more than momentary thrills.
Doga Kanojia is Vedika's ex-boyfriend and a local womanizer who embodies manipulation and risk. He schemes to drive Vedika away and makes plans to move to Canada. His presence intensifies the conflict and catalyzes the couple's choices about their future together.
The movie is a comedy and romance that falls under relationship comedy with crude humor and satire. While it deals with serious themes like infidelity, the tone remains light and the consequences are treated with a comic touch. The ending is definitively happy with full reconciliation and personal growth for the protagonist.
